This creamy spinach blend combines softened cream cheese, sour cream, and mayonnaise with garlic, spring onions, and flavorful cheeses for a smooth, savory treat. Wilted spinach is delicately folded in, then baked until golden and bubbling. Perfectly complemented by crunchy sourdough bread, it offers a satisfying balance of creamy texture and hearty bread for dipping. Simple to prepare and ideal for gatherings, this dish brings warmth and rich flavors to any occasion.
There's something about the smell of cream cheese melting into sour cream that instantly makes a kitchen feel like home. I discovered this spinach dip almost by accident one winter evening when a friend texted that she was bringing people over in two hours, and I had nothing but frozen spinach and a block of cream cheese staring back at me from the fridge. What started as mild panic became one of those dishes that gets requested every single gathering now, and I've made it so many times I could do it half asleep.
I'll never forget watching my mom take one bite at a family dinner and immediately ask for the recipe, only to be shocked it didn't involve fresh herbs or some secret technique. That moment taught me that sometimes the most impressive dishes are the ones where you stop overthinking and just let good ingredients speak for themselves, warm and bubbling straight from the oven.
Ingredients
- Frozen chopped spinach (300 g): Thaw it completely and squeeze it dry—this single step prevents a watery dip and is the difference between silky and sad.
- Cream cheese (200 g): Let it soften on the counter for 15 minutes before mixing; cold cream cheese fights you the whole way.
- Sour cream (120 g): The tangy backbone that keeps this from tasting one-note and heavy.
- Mayonnaise (120 g): Trust this ingredient; it adds richness and helps the dip stay creamy when heated.
- Parmesan cheese (100 g): Grate it fresh if you can—pre-shredded varieties have anti-caking agents that sometimes feel gritty.
- Mozzarella cheese (100 g): Shredded mozzarella is your secret to that melty, almost stretchy texture when it comes out of the oven.
- Garlic (2 cloves): Mince it finely so it distributes evenly and doesn't announce itself with sharp bursts of flavor.
- Spring onions (2): The bright, mild onion flavor cuts through the richness without overpowering.
- Salt, pepper, and nutmeg: Nutmeg sounds odd, but just a pinch adds a warm complexity that makes people wonder what your secret is.
- Sourdough bread: The tangy crust and tender crumb are perfect for scooping without tearing, and it won't get soggy as fast as softer breads.
Instructions
- Set your oven and gather your team:
- Preheat the oven to 180°C (350°F) while you assemble everything on the counter—this is the moment where you realize how few ingredients you actually need. Having everything visible makes the process feel almost meditative.
- Build your creamy foundation:
- In a large bowl, combine the softened cream cheese, sour cream, and mayonnaise, mixing until the texture is completely smooth with no lumps hiding anywhere. This base is what makes the magic happen, so don't rush it.
- Layer in the flavor and texture:
- Add the Parmesan, mozzarella, minced garlic, spring onions, salt, pepper, and nutmeg, stirring until everything is evenly distributed and the mixture smells incredible. You'll notice how the cheese makes the mixture thicker and more luxurious with each stir.
- Fold in the spinach gently:
- Add the thawed, well-drained spinach and fold it in slowly until the green is completely incorporated and the dip looks like a vibrant, creamy garden. This is where the dip transforms from a pale mixture into something that actually looks finished.
- Transfer to your baking dish:
- Spread the mixture evenly into a small baking dish, smoothing the top with a spatula so it bakes uniformly. You can make small swirls on top if you want it to look a little fancy, but honestly, heat is going to do the work for you.
- Bake until it's bubbling and golden:
- Place it in the oven for 20 minutes, or until the edges are bubbling gently and the top is lightly golden—you'll know it's ready when the aroma hits you and you can see the first wisps of heat rising. Don't overbake or the cheese will separate and weep, so set a timer and trust it.
- Prepare your bread while waiting:
- Slice or cube your sourdough bread and arrange it on a serving platter, giving yourself the gift of a hot dip meeting room-temperature bread for the perfect first scoop. Cold bread also means it won't get limp by the time your guests finish the dip.
- Serve immediately and watch the magic:
- Bring the hot spinach dip straight to the table and watch people's faces light up as they take that first dip-loaded bite. The warmth and creaminess are gone within minutes if you let it sit, so serve while it's at its absolute best.
There was a moment at a potluck where someone's aunt asked if this was from a restaurant, and I remember feeling this small, silly pride over a dip made mostly from a grocery store cream cheese. It was the moment I realized that making people happy in the kitchen isn't about complexity or rare ingredients—it's about showing up with something warm and genuine.
Why This Dip Works for Every Occasion
The beauty of a spinach dip is that it doesn't ask much of you, but it delivers every single time. It works at a casual game night with friends just as easily as it does at a more formal gathering, and it's substantial enough that people feel like they're eating something real instead of just picking at appetizers. I've learned that the meals we remember aren't always the complicated ones—they're the ones where the flavors are right, the temperature is perfect, and you didn't stress yourself out making them.
Make It Your Own
Once you've made this dip once, you'll start seeing it as a canvas for your own kitchen preferences. I've added everything from fresh dill to sun-dried tomatoes depending on what was in my fridge, and the dip has been gracious enough to accept almost any green or herb I've thrown at it. The core formula is so solid that it forgives experimentation, which is honestly the sign of a truly great recipe.
The Practical Side of Spinach Dip
What I love most about this recipe is that you can make it the day before and simply bake it fresh just before people arrive, turning it into the kind of dish that works for people with actual lives and schedules. The flavors actually improve overnight as the herbs and garlic have time to mingle, so you're not just saving time—you're making it better.
- If you're serving a crowd, double or triple the recipe in multiple small baking dishes so everyone gets warm dip and not cold leftovers.
- A pinch of chili flakes or a squeeze of lemon juice right before serving adds brightness that people always ask about.
- Greek yogurt can replace the sour cream if you want something lighter, though the tangy edge will be a bit softer.
This is the kind of recipe that quietly becomes part of your cooking identity, the thing people ask you to bring, the one you make without thinking. That's when you know you've found something worth holding onto.
Recipe FAQs
- → What type of cheese is used in the spinach dip?
-
Grated Parmesan and shredded mozzarella cheeses add savory depth and melt into a smooth, creamy texture.
- → Can I prepare the dip ahead of time?
-
Yes, the mixture can be prepared a day in advance and baked just before serving for optimum freshness.
- → How should the spinach be prepared before mixing?
-
Frozen chopped spinach should be thawed completely and thoroughly squeezed dry to remove excess moisture.
- → Are there any suggested flavor variations?
-
Adding a pinch of chili flakes or a squeeze of lemon juice can enhance the flavor with subtle heat or brightness.
- → What bread pairs best with this dip?
-
Crusty sourdough bread cut into bite-sized cubes or slices works perfectly to soak up the creamy dip.